Gas Rebate Credit Card On The Loose
Everyday, many people use their vehicles to go to work, to grocery stores, malls, or any particular place they would like to go. Vehicles need gasoline, and to some people, buying gasoline frequently is a bit heavy on the pocket.
But did you know that you could actually save a lot of money in going to a gas station almost every day? Yes, and that can happen if you have a gas rebate credit card.
Don't expect for the price of gas to come down. Almost every commodity in the market has their prices soaring higher and higher. In purchasing fuel for your vehicle, you can get a discount if you only have a gas rebate card.
Gas rebate credit cards works like that of cash back cards, but instead of receiving it once every year; you will be able to receive a certain amount in credit form each month.
Gas rebate cards are widely available, and all you have to do is to select the best one. The card member earns interest; and this interest greatly varies depending on the offer. Introductory offers for gas rebate cards have a maximum rate of 6% in order to attract customers, but after some time, it is also reduced.
There are gas rebate cards offered by many gas companies which are called 'brand specific' cards and is used only in a specific location. This is an advantage for people who purchase their gasoline or fuel in one particular station. But if shopping around is your habit, or if you frequently have out-of-town travels, this would be a disadvantage to you.
Because of certain advantages and disadvantages, most of today's companies which cater to general purpose cards are offering gas rewards. The amount is accumulated every time you make a purchase from any gas company.
The rebates given every month also varies, so before making any application, you should make sure that it is fitting to your needs. There are different rebate types given to customers, therefore you should ask for the type before proceeding with the application. Usually, rebates are given every month in credit form to a specified account of a card member or holder.
You should also consider these things: (1) gas rebate credit cards have certain restrictions, and (2) other companies set limits on the amount of annual rebates.
Annual fees should not be a cause of worry because most of gas rebate cards don't charge any. However, you must be aware that the interest varies month after month. And if you can't pay all your dues at the end of the month, and have a remaining balance, this is of utmost concern for you.
Everything has limitations, and gas rebate cards are no exemption. Before selecting one particular card, you must compare all their advantages and disadvantages while considering your current needs.

Discover Credit Card Home Page
The Discover credit card made its world debut in 1985 when it was introduced by Sears. It quickly developed popularity in the competitive world of credit cards because it offered a cash back rewards that offered as much as one percent back on certain purchases, it had no annual fees, was the only card accepted by the United States Customs Service which meant it could be used to pay customs duty. In 1997 Discover credit card became a part of the Morley Stanwood empire when the Dean Witter discover group merged with Morley Stanwood.
Business Credit Card Application Needs Good Credit Report
As with a personal credit card, the business credit card is a highly efficient method for obtaining, granting, and expending loans. The applicant for a business credit card needs do little more than fill out a brief application or key in a few bits of information over the Internet. In most cases, the customer is granted a line of credit, which can be accessed and expended quickly and easily each time the business credit card is used. Assuming that the customer has a good credit record, the credit limit will automatically be increased when it is reached, thereby increasing the loan amount without much effort on the part of the business credit card holder.
